Gliding Joint Angular Movement. Planar joints have bones with articulating surfaces that are flat or slightly curved. Gliding movements occur as relatively flat bone surfaces move past each other. A gliding joint, also known as a plane joint or planar joint, is a common type of synovial joint formed between bones that meet at flat or nearly flat articular surfaces. The movement of synovial joints can be classified as one of four different types: Gliding, angular, rotational, or special movement. They produce very little rotation or angular movement of the bones.
